What is Cultivate?
Cultivate is an online resource for kitchen inspiration. Our inspiration gallery features kitchen photos from our community of designers, architects, and manufacturers, in addition to our own selected collection of kitchen environments. The Cultivate community is invited to explore the many design alternatives as a way to discover their own point of view. Our Kitchen Articles section contains a knowledge base of topical articles that help orient homeowners to what they should consider when planning a kitchen remodel. Cultivate members are also invited to connect with designers and other trade professionals as they begin planning their own projects. Cultivate is produced and managed by Williams-Sonoma, Inc.

Who should create a 'Showroom' or 'Manufacturer' profile?
If you produce your own products and typically rely on a dealer network or distributor to sell them, then you should create a Manufacturer profile.

If you have one or more showrooms where you display and sell your product, then you should create a Showroom profile to encourage homeowners and designers to visit your locations. At this time, you (or your showroom manager) will need to create a separate profile for each Showroom location. A Showroom profile is also ideal for a business that represents and sells multiple product categories and brands. You can specify each category of product you carry (e.g., appliances, tile & stone, cabinetry, etc.) in order to have your business display in respective search queries.

If your primary business is kitchen design, you should complete a Designer or Architect profile.
